Carl Lee Harris

October 31, 1925 — September 20, 2010

Carl Lee Harris, 84, of Orange, passed away on Monday, September 20, 2010, at St. Elizabeth Hospital in Beaumont.

Funeral services will be 2:00 p.m. Sunday, September 26, 2010, at Claybar Funeral Home Chapel in Orange. Officiating will be Reverend Jeff Bell of Calvary Baptist Church in Port Acres. Burial will follow at Evergreen Cemetery in Orange.

Visitation will be from 5:00-9:00 p.m. Saturday, at the funeral home.

Born in Orange on October 31, 1925, Carl was the son of Australia Young and Hugh Harris. He retired from Chevron in Orange and was a member of Cove Baptist Church. He was on the school board at Cove ISD and was a board member for WESCO Little League.

Carl was a HUGE fan of the Dallas Cowboys. He devoted much of his time tending his yard and growing a variety of plants.
